To end up being a Level 2 Electrician, a considerable commitment to training and strenuous evaluation is needed. It's not merely an add-on to a basic electrical licence; it's an unique and elevated credentials. Generally, an electrician needs to initially finish a Certificate III in Electrotechnology Electrician and gain several years of practical experience. Following this, they need to undertake further recognized training, often provided by Registered Training Organisations (RTOs) with specific proficiency in high-voltage and network-related work. This sophisticated training covers vital areas such as overhead and underground service line setup, upkeep, and repair, frequently including live work procedures and the strict safety procedures associated with working near or on the circulation network.
The training also looks into complicated fault finding and rectification on service lines, metering equipment, and associated facilities. Imagine a scenario where a storm has actually lowered a service line to a property; it's the Level 2 Electrician who has the proficiency and the regulatory authority to securely and effectively address such a hazardous circumstance. Their understanding extends to understanding the intricate network diagrams, adhering to stringent utility service rules, and mastering making use of specialised equipment developed for working at height or in confined spaces, all while prioritising safety above all else.

They are authorised to connect brand-new residential or commercial properties to the grid, consisting of the setup of new service mains, metering enclosures, and switchboards. This often includes communicating directly with energy merchants and network service providers to make sure compliance with all appropriate standards and policies. Furthermore, they carry out important upgrades to existing service device, such as increasing the capacity of service mains to accommodate higher power demands from new home appliances or restorations.
An essential element of their role involves the disconnection and reconnection of supply for numerous factors, consisting of electrical upgrades, demolitions, or repair work to the service line itself. This requires meticulous preparation and execution to ensure very little disturbance and optimum security for both the occupants of the home and the public. They are likewise the go-to experts for correcting flaws identified on consumer mains or service equipment by other electricians or network inspectors. These problems, if left unaddressed, might posture substantial security dangers or lead to power blackouts.
Moreover, these extremely knowledgeable tradespersons are associated with the installation and maintenance of private poles and overhead lines, which are common in rural and semi-rural locations. This work requires a deep understanding of structural stability, earthing systems, and greenery management protocols to prevent dangers and make sure dependable power delivery throughout expansive residential or commercial properties. They are typically hired to inspect and license these personal installations, offering assurance to property owners.
